
Meet Me In Beaverton
Meet Me In Beaverton is all about the people and places you should know in Beaverton, Oregon and the surrounding area. In each episode, we interview people in the Beaverton community who own or do business with you, their neighbors. Sure, we’ll talk a bit about their business, but only just a bit. Mostly, this is about introducing you to your Beaverton neighbors, to hear their stories, learn about who they are, where they came from, and maybe have a laugh or two or learn something interesting along the way. And then yeah, we’ll also let you know about what they do and how they can help you. The goal here is to encourage you to buy local, and more than that, to know who it is you’re dealing with when you walk in that shop or restaurant, or make that call for a service. Meet Me In Beaverton is about helping you build connections to your community because when that happens, all those digital walls and silos we hear so much about?, they’ll come tumbling down. Meet Me in Beaverton is produced by LeftBrainRightBrain Marketing in partnership with The Beaverton Area Chamber of Commerce.
